R
Rick Gonsalves Review of Cranfords
Cranfords is a great company to work with. Their w...
Cranfords is a great company to work with. Their website is easy to navigate and their customer service is top-notch. I am very impressed with the quality of their products and the promptness of their delivery. I highly recommend Cranfords.biz!

Comments: